色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

如何使用binlog實現MySQL數據同步

呂致盈2年前24瀏覽0評論

log成為了MySQL數據庫同步的重要工具。

loglog文件,我們可以獲取到MySQL數據庫中的所有數據修改信息,從而實現數據同步。

log實現MySQL數據同步的步驟如下:

logyfyf中加入以下配置:

ysqld]ysql

2. 然后,需要在MySQL數據庫中設置需要同步的表。可以通過執行以下SQL語句來實現:

logat = 'ROW';logage = 'FULL';

CREATE USER 'repl_user'@'%' IDENTIFIED BY 'password';

GRANT REPLICATION SLAVE ON *.* TO 'repl_user'@'%';

FLUSH PRIVILEGES;

FLUSH TABLES WITH READ LOCK;

SHOW MASTER STATUS;

其中,repl_user為同步用戶的用戶名,password為同步用戶的密碼。

logyfyf中加入以下配置:

ysqld]

server-id=2ysqlysql

log-slave-updates=1ly=1

其中,server-id為目標系統的MySQL實例ID。

4. 最后,需要在目標系統中啟動MySQL實例,并執行以下SQL語句來啟動數據同步:

ysqlasterysql.000001', MASTER_LOG_POS=4;

START SLAVE;

ysqlasterysqlloglog文件位置。

logloglog文件并執行相應的數據同步操作。